  • What the Bible Actually Says About the Substitute Lamb (Christ Our Passover)
    Mar 17 2026
    The Bible reveals that salvation required a substitute.

    In this episode of The Charge, we examine what the Bible actually says about the substitute lamb and how the Passover in Exodus 12 points directly to Jesus Christ.

    When judgment came to Egypt, the firstborn should have died. But God provided a substitute — a lamb without blemish whose blood protected the household.

    This powerful picture reveals the doctrine of substitution and explains why the New Testament declares:

    “Christ our Passover is sacrificed for us.”

    In this teaching we explore:

    • The lamb without blemish
    • Christ our Passover
    • The doctrine of substitution
    • The exchange of the gospel

    Key Scriptures:

    Exodus 12:5
    Exodus 12:13
    1 Corinthians 5:7
    Romans 6:23

    The lamb died so the firstborn could live.

    Christ died so sinners could live.

  • The Blood Must Be Applied — Protection Comes by Faith (Exodus 12)
    Mar 10 2026
    The blood must be applied for salvation. In this episode of The Charge, we explore Exodus 12 and Romans 5 to understand why protection comes by faith and why the blood of Jesus must be personally applied.

    This is part two of the series Seven Truths About the Blood.

    In the Passover account, the lamb was slain and the blood was placed in a basin. But the basin did not save the people. The blood had to be applied to the doorposts for judgment to pass over.

    In this teaching you will learn:

    • Why the blood must be applied
    • How faith activates the covering
    • Why salvation is personal
    • The connection between Passover and the cross

    Key Scriptures:

    Exodus 12:7
    Exodus 12:13
    Romans 5:1
